Livonia
Livonia has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$53,750. Population has fallen 15% since 2000, a loss of 17 residents. 8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 36%. Median home value has more than doubled since 2000, reaching $113,600. The poverty rate of 21.1% is well above the national figure. Households here earn about 25% less than the Indiana median.
